WebTransfer Day refers to the day that the Danish West Indies were formally transferred to the United States, becoming the U.S. Virgin Islands. At 4:00pm on March 31, 1917, the United States purchased the Danish West Indies from Denmark for twenty-five million dollars. At that time, a formal ceremony was held here in the islands while ...

This image suggests the … WebThe Danish military accepted plans for the helmet in 1923 from army Captain H. E. Johnsen and chief engineer G.A.P. Willadsen-Nielsen. [1] The helmet saw combat during the German invasion of Denmark, Operation Weserübung, on April 9 1940, and very limited use with the Danish volunteers in Finland during the Winter War .

WebFeb 23, 2024 · The VOSS equipment, includes a new helmet from the Galvion company (formerly Revision Military) and the SMART vest developed by the Israeli companies Elbit and Marom Dolphin. Testing and implementation of this new equipment has been managed by the STRONG project – STRONG stands for Soldier TRansformation ONGoing. WebThe Danish West Indies was a Danish colony in the Caribbean from 1672 to 1917. This collection contains birth, marriage, and death records dating between 1600 and 1920 from the Danish West Indies. The islands—St. Thomas, St. John, and St. Croix—were sold to the U.S. in 1917 and are now known as the U.S. Virgin Islands.
